What is a Manual Treadmill?
A Manual Treadmill Price treadmill is a piece of exercise equipment that depends on the user's own energy to power the treadmill belt. Unlike motorized treadmills, these devices do not have an electric motor and do not need a power outlet. Users propel the belt by walking or running, making Cheap Manual Treadmill treadmills an excellent choice for those looking to take part in a simple and effective workout.
Benefits of Using a Manual Treadmill
Manual treadmills use many advantages, consisting of:
| Benefits | Details |
|---|---|
| Economical | Without a motor, manual treadmills usually cost less than their motorized equivalents. |
| Mobility | Numerous manual treadmills are light-weight and collapsible, making them much easier to transfer and store. |
| Burn More Calories | Users frequently burn more calories on a manual treadmill due to the fact that they need to use their own momentum. |
| Lower Maintenance | With less moving parts, manual treadmills need less upkeep than motorized models. |
| Simpleness | Easy to use, with no complicated settings, ideal for beginners or those who choose straightforward workouts. |
| Versatility | Ideal for various exercise types, including walking, jogging, and running. |
Choosing the Right Manual Treadmill
When selecting a manual treadmill, possible buyers ought to consider a number of factors:
- Weight Capacity: Check the treadmill's maximum weight limitation and guarantee it accommodates all users.
- Belt Size: A larger belt offers more space to walk or run comfortably.
- Incline Options: Many Manual Treadmil treadmills featured adjustable inclines, allowing users to customize workouts and increase intensity.
- Resilience: Look for treadmills made from durable products to make sure longevity.
- Mobility: If you prepare to move or store the treadmill often, select a lightweight, collapsible model.
- Convenience Features: Non-slip manages, cushioned surfaces, and shock absorption can enhance the overall experience.

Safety Tips for Using a Manual Treadmill
To take full advantage of safety while utilizing a manual treadmill, think about the following:
- Warm-Up: Always begin with a warm-up to prepare your muscles and joints.
- Appropriate Footwear: Wear comfortable, supportive shoes to minimize the danger of injury.
- Stay Hydrated: Keep a water bottle close-by and take breaks as required.
- Monitor Heart Rate: Pay attention to your heart rate and change the intensity appropriately.
- Use Handrails: If readily available, utilize hand rails for stability, especially when changing the incline or speed.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Are manual treadmills efficient for weight loss?Yes, manual treadmills can be reliable for weight reduction, as they need users to exert their own energy to move the belt. This typically leads to greater calorie burn compared to motorized Treadmills In Uk.
2. Can manual treadmills be used for running?Yes, many manual treadmills are appropriate for both walking and running, however it's vital to select a design with a larger running surface area for comfort.
3. Do manual treadmills need electricity?No, manual treadmills run exclusively on human power, making them an excellent choice for those without simple access to electricity.
4. How do I preserve a manual treadmill?Upkeep is simple; routinely wipe down the surface area, check for loose parts, and lubricate the belt if recommended by the manufacturer.
5. Exists a weight limitation for manual treadmills?Yes, each manual treadmill design has a specified weight limitation. It's essential to stick to this limit for security and the longevity of the devices.
